C the Signs

Software Engineer – Mobile, React Native

C the Signs

full-time

Posted on:

Location Type: Remote

Location: MassachusettsWisconsinUnited States

Visit company website

Explore more

AI Apply
Apply

About the role

  • Design, develop, and maintain robust mobile applications using React Native and TypeScript.
  • Lead mobile development projects from conception to deployment, ensuring quality and adherence to timelines.
  • Architect and implement scalable, maintainable mobile solutions that integrate seamlessly with backend services.
  • Develop intuitive, responsive user interfaces that provide exceptional user experiences across devices and screen sizes.
  • Collaborate with product managers, designers, backend engineers, and other stakeholders to translate requirements into technical specifications.
  • Mentor and guide junior developers, fostering a collaborative and growth-oriented team culture focused on mobile excellence.
  • Stay up-to-date with industry trends and emerging mobile technologies to continuously improve our applications.

Requirements

  • 5+ years of experience as a Mobile Developer, with at least 3+ years focused on React Native development.
  • Proven experience designing and building scalable mobile applications deployed to the App Store and Google Play.
  • Strong proficiency in React Native, React (v.18), TypeScript, and JavaScript (ES6+).
  • Experience with native mobile development (iOS/Swift or Android/Kotlin) for building custom native modules.
  • Strong understanding of RESTful APIs, mobile architecture patterns, and state management solutions (Redux, MobX, or similar).
  • Proficiency in mobile CI/CD pipelines and deployment processes for iOS and Android.
  • Experience with mobile testing frameworks (Jest, Detox, or similar) and debugging tools.
  • Solid understanding of mobile security principles, data encryption, and best practices.
  • Experience with performance optimization, memory management, and mobile app profiling.
  • Experience with Agile development methodologies.
  • Excellent problem-solving and analytical skills, with a strong attention to detail.
  • Strong communication and interpersonal skills, capable of presenting ideas clearly to technical and non-technical audiences.
  • Ability to thrive in a fast-paced, collaborative environment and adapt to changing priorities.
  • Experience in healthcare or health-tech mobile development is a plus.
  • Experience with offline-first architecture and data synchronization is also a plus.
Benefits
  • Health Care Plan (Medical, Dental & Vision)
  • Retirement Plan (401k, IRA)
  • Life Insurance (Basic, Voluntary & AD&D)
  • Paid Time Off (Vacation, Sick & Public Holidays)
  • Work From Home
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
React NativeTypeScriptJavaScriptiOSSwiftAndroidKotlinRESTful APIsReduxAgile
Soft Skills
problem-solvinganalytical skillsattention to detailcommunication skillsinterpersonal skillsmentoringcollaborationadaptabilityleadershipteam culture